The chassis designed for the Remington 700 Sendero rifle typically features a heavy, rigid construction intended for long-range precision shooting. These specialized components are often crafted from synthetic materials like fiberglass or molded polymers for enhanced durability and weather resistance, or from wood laminates for traditional aesthetics and stability. Common design elements include a wide, flat forend for enhanced stability when shooting from rests or bipods, along with an adjustable cheekpiece and buttpad for personalized comfort and consistent cheek weld. Some variants may also incorporate aluminum bedding blocks or chassis systems for increased rigidity and accuracy.
A well-designed chassis plays a crucial role in maximizing the accuracy potential of the Remington 700 Sendero platform. Its inherent rigidity minimizes flexing and warping under stress, which can negatively impact point of impact. The adjustable features allow for a custom fit to the shooter, promoting consistent shooting form and reducing felt recoil. Historically, these rifles and their associated components have been favored by long-range target shooters and some law enforcement agencies for their precision and reliability. The emphasis on stability and adjustability contributes directly to improved shot placement at extended distances.
